加入收藏 | 设为首页 | 会员中心 | 我要投稿 晋中站长网 (https://www.0354zz.com/)- 科技、容器安全、数据加密、云日志、云数据迁移!
当前位置: 首页 > 运营中心 > 建站资源 > 策划 > 正文

网站API接口设计原则及调用规范指南

发布时间:2024-11-26 12:52:44 所属栏目:策划 来源:DaWei
导读:   一、前言  随着互联网的快速发展,API接口已成为应用程序之间进行数据交换和通信的重要手段。一个好的API接口设计能够提供更好的用户体验和数据交互效果,同时也能提高应用程序的安全

  一、前言

  随着互联网的快速发展,API接口已成为应用程序之间进行数据交换和通信的重要手段。一个好的API接口设计能够提供更好的用户体验和数据交互效果,同时也能提高应用程序的安全性和稳定性。因此,本文将介绍网站API接口的设计与调用规范,帮助开发人员更好地设计和使用API接口。

  二、API接口设计原则

  1. 明确性:API接口的定义和功能描述应该清晰明确,易于理解。

  2. 简洁性:API接口的设计应该尽可能简单明了,减少不必要的复杂性。

  3. 可靠性:API接口应该具备高可用性和稳定性,保证数据传输的安全性和准确性。

  4. 可扩展性:API接口的设计应该考虑到未来的扩展需求,方便添加新功能和调整现有功能。

  三、API接口设计要素

  1. 请求方法(HTTP Verbs):根据具体需求选择合适的请求方法,如GET、POST、PUT、DELETE等。

AI图片所创,仅供参考

  2. 请求URL:URL应清晰明了,方便理解和记忆。

  3. 请求参数:请求参数应尽可能简洁,且应遵循一定的规范和标准。

  4. 响应数据:响应数据应具有可读性和规范性,且应包含必要的信息和元数据。

  5. 错误处理:API接口应该具备完善的错误处理机制,能够准确返回错误信息和状态码。

  四、API接口调用规范

  1. 请求格式:请求的格式应该遵循HTTP协议规范,包括请求头、请求体等部分。

  2. 请求头(Headers):请求头中应包含必要的认证信息和请求标识。

  3. 请求体(Body):当需要传递复杂数据时,应使用JSON格式作为请求体。

  4. 响应格式:响应的格式也应该遵循HTTP协议规范,包括状态码、响应头和响应体等部分。

  5. 状态码(Status Codes):状态码应遵循HTTP协议规范,准确反映请求的处理结果。

  6. 响应头(Headers):响应头中应包含必要的元数据和认证信息。

  7. 响应体(Body):响应体中应包含必要的数据和信息,以便调用方理解和处理。

  五、总结

  本文介绍了网站API接口设计与调用规范,包括设计原则、设计要素和调用规范等方面的内容。在实际开发中,开发人员应该遵循这些规范和建议,设计和使用稳定、可靠、安全和可扩展的API接口,提高应用程序的性能和用户体验。同时,开发人员还应该不断学习和掌握新技术和标准,不断完善和优化API接口的设计和使用方式,以满足不断变化的市场需求和技术发展。

(编辑:晋中站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章